Poole 17th & 18th June anyone?

Hi folks,

I'm getting together a few people to do a couple of nice dives on the weekend of 17th & 18th. At the moment I have some spare spaces on each day.

On Saturday 17th the plan is to dive a very nice armed trawler, the Warwick deeping from Sha King.

Wreck info is here
The boat info is here

On Sunday the plan is to dive the Baron Gariock, a 265ft WW1 wreck which still yeilds some nice finds.

Diving is from Big Dinghy

Both wrecks are at the upper end of sports diver range and suitable for a dived up sports diver or dive leader. a 30% nitrox mix is ideal.

second dives offered on both days, cost will be £35 - £40 per day.

If you fancy joining us let me know. If you would like further info drop me a pm for my mobile number. Its a lovely neap tide, reasonable departure times and the boats out of swanage are very busy.
